WebThe bending moment(M) at any point in the beam is equal to the force applied multiplied by the distance from that point to the point of application. It is therefore zero at the free end of the beam, and maximum at the fixed end. This means that there is no stress at the free end of the beam, and a maximum stress at the fixed end.

Steel or concrete is most commonly used to construct cantilever beams. … WebFig. 4.1(a) shows of a cantilever beam with rectangular cross section, which can be subjected to bending vibration by giving a small initial displacement at the free end; and … WebApr 14, 2024 · Clamped end of a microcantilever beam is gripped inside a holder, and a piezo actuator transversely displaces the base. When the piezo is actuated at the natural frequency, a very small displacement given causes a large displacement of the cantilever tip, and it is measured using a detection system. That is called resonant excitation. first rated
